床位的分配与回收数据结构课程设计报告
《床位的分配与回收数据结构课程设计报告》由会员分享,可在线阅读,更多相关《床位的分配与回收数据结构课程设计报告(39页珍藏版)》请在毕设资料网上搜索。
1、- 1 - 模拟旅馆管理系统的一个功能-床位的分配与回收 一、一、问题描述问题描述 1.11.1 问题的描述问题的描述 某旅馆有 n 个等级的房间,第 i 等级有 ai个房间,每个等级有 bi床位(1in) 。 试模拟旅馆管理系统中床位分配和回收的功能,设计能为单个旅客分配床位,在其离 店便回收床位(供下次分配)的算法。 1.21.2 输入数据输入数据 对房间信息进行初始化,包括房间的类别、数量以及房间和床位的计费标准; 分配时,输入旅客姓名、年龄、性别、到达日期和所需房间等级; 回收时,输入房间等级、房间号和床位号。 1.31.3 输出数据输出数据 分配成功时打印旅客姓名、年龄、到达日期、房
2、间等级、房间号码和床位号码。 分配不成功时,如所有等级均无床位,则打印“客满”信息;如旅客需要的等级均无空 床位,则打印“是否愿意更换等级?”的询问信息。若旅客愿意更换,则重新输入有关 信息,再进行分配,否则分配工作结束。 二、需求分析二、需求分析 2 2.1.1 需求分析需求分析 经过分析,程序要有以下几个功能: 程序启动的时候应该能够对旅馆的信息进行初始化,并且可以让不同的进行手动初始化; 当客户到来的时候,可以登录客户的信息,并且根据旅馆的情况和客 户的要求进行分配床位; 当客户结账的时候,可以打印其账单,并且将床位回收; 在进行输入信息的时候,应该有检查错误的功能,防止输入的信息超出正
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 床位 分配 回收 数据结构 课程设计 报告
